You can do the same thing with the file in the download for Creative. Steps:
Go to Run.
Type in %temp%\www.minecraft.net
Open the "Minecraft" folder.
Right click the Minecraft jar file, and click "Add to Archive" or whatever to WinRAR, 7-ZIP, etc.
Drag and drop the png's where they need to be.
Load up MineCraft in Creative mode.
And there you go.
